What Bank Statement Is and Why It Matters

A bank statement is the core proof that you can afford your trip — it must show sufficient, stable, genuinely available funds. Officers use it as one piece of a bigger picture — so what matters most is that it is genuine, legible, and lines up with everything else in your file. A document that contradicts your other paperwork does more harm than no document at all, which is why consistency is the theme running through everything below.

What to Include

A strong bank statement contains several months of transactions (not just a balance), the account holder's name, the bank's letterhead or stamp, and a closing balance that meets the requirement. Think of it as answering the officer's unspoken question in advance: it should leave no ambiguity about the facts it's meant to establish. Anything vague, undated, or unsigned (where a signature is expected) weakens it, so aim for a version that is specific, complete, and verifiable.

The Right Format

Presentation matters more than people expect. Keep your bank statement clean and professional: official letterhead or issuing authority where relevant, clear dates, legible text, and a certified translation if it isn't in the destination's official language. Provide originals or properly certified copies as required, and never alter a document — even a small "tidy-up" can be read as tampering and is the single most damaging thing you can do.

A Sample Structure

While exact formats vary by issuer, a reliable bank statement follows a simple logic: it identifies who it concerns, states the key facts clearly (dates, amounts, relationships, or specifications as relevant), and is verifiable — signed, stamped, dated, or issued by a recognised authority. Lay it out so an officer can grasp the essential facts in seconds, and make sure every detail on it matches your passport, your application form, and your supporting documents.

Common Mistakes to Avoid

  • Showing only a single recent balance.
  • A large unexplained deposit just before applying.
  • A statement with no name or bank identification.
  • Inconsistencies with your passport, form, or other documents.
  • Submitting an altered or fabricated version — an instant, lasting problem.
